Abstract Text In the last years, variable annuities, a life-insurance product, have assumed an increasing importance in the academic research. The purpose of this thesis is to analyse the systemic impact caused by the hedging of variable annuities. In order to provide an idea of the main features of this product, a review concerning variable annuities is proposed in the rst chapter. Moreover, in order to analyse the guarantees risk exposure, the same chapter presents Greeks. The second chapter deals with dynamic Delta hedging, with the aim to show the effectiveness of this strategy. In the last chapter, a review about systemic risk studies is presented, with a speci c focus on systemic risk in the insurance sector. In addition, in this last chapter, a theoretical answer to the main question of the thesis is provided.
